Aims & objectives

The program Joint Civic Education aims at empowering youth from South Caucasus to play an active role in their local societies and to contribute to the peaceuilding process in the region. The goal of the seminar was to introduce project management and its aspects to the young activists incl. , goals and objectives setting, teamwork, conflict management, time management, fundraising, budgeting, project proposal writing, PR, seminar designing, event management etc. The training combined theoretical inputs with practical excercises and trainings of specific tools.

Target group & international/intercultural composition of the group & team

The participants of the Joint Civic Education programme are young people 18-25 y.o. from Armenia, Azerbaijan and Georgia in total about 30 people participated in the seminar. The trainers team consisted of 4 people - 2 Georgians, 1 Russian and 1 Pole.

Outcomes of the activity

The outcomes of the practice seminar were project proposals written by the participants assisted by the trainers during the practice seminar. A report and a photo documentation were written.
